Addepar
Addepar
Enterprise multi-product wealth & investment management platform used by RIAs, family offices, private banks and institutions to aggregate multi-asset, multi-entity portfolios and deliver portfolio accounting, analytics, trading, reporting and client portal experiences on a single data model. Capabilities such as Addepar Trading, Navigator, Alts Data Management, and premium market/benchmark feeds are licensed as separate modules or data packages, and the open API is available only to firms with an active Addepar subscription. Included vs premium market data feeds (e.g., ICE Pricing vs Private Fund Benchmarks) are explicitly labeled in the Integration Center.[0,7,8,9,10,11]

Key features
- Multi-product web and data platform for wealth managers, family offices, private banks and institutions, aggregating “every ownable asset” across 50+ markets worldwide into a single source of truth for even the most complex portfolios.
- Comprehensive, customizable portfolio reporting and dashboards that can combine any asset class or currency, with drag-and-drop templates, firm-branded layouts and client-ready visualizations for different stakeholder audiences.[1,15]
- Data aggregation from custodians such as Fidelity and Schwab plus leading market data providers, with the option to manually manage holdings so private investments like real estate and private equity can be viewed alongside publicly traded securities.
- Broad multi-asset security model supporting stocks, bonds, ETFs, mutual funds, closed-end funds, currencies, real estate, private funds, hedge funds, options, futures, digital assets and generic custom assets via rich model types.
- Integrated market-data feeds including ICE end-of-day pricing for global equities, mutual funds, ETFs and related security types, plus FX rates, reference data, benchmarks, constituents and other datasets—some included with Addepar and others licensed as premium feeds.[9,10]
- Portfolio trading and rebalancing (Addepar Trading) uses aggregated Addepar data to align portfolios to target models and rebalance across accounts, households or entire books of business, with a drift-monitoring widget now available directly in dashboards for Trading clients.[0,13]
- Navigator portfolio projection tool, available as an add-on, lets advisors simulate scenarios and forecast cash flows for complex private-market investments using capital market assumptions and private-fund cash-flow models.
- Alts Data Management module centralizes alternative investment data and documents in one platform, automates alternatives data workflows and enables seamless performance analysis and reporting across traditional and opaque asset classes.[7,14]
- Optional Private Fund Benchmarks data sets provide aggregated private-fund performance benchmarks (e.g., private credit, private equity, real assets, real estate, venture capital) with quarterly and since-inception series to support alternatives analytics.
- Tax-aware portfolio accounting with rich tax attributes (realized and unrealized gains, disposed costs and proceeds), configurable closing methods (FIFO, LIFO and Average Cost for Canada), and workflows for proactive tax-lot maintenance and accurate, full-portfolio cost-basis reporting—including alternatives maintained manually.
- Most custodians send tax-lot data that automatically populates cost basis and tax attributes, while users can manually maintain tax lots and cost basis for alternative assets not fed through custodians to ensure complete tax views across the portfolio.
- Transactions and portfolio APIs expose granular data such as tax-lot flags, wash-sale indicators, fee and tax fields, income and distribution breakdowns, benchmarks and numerous transaction attributes, designed for querying or exporting normalized data into external data warehouses.
- Open REST API secured with OAuth or API keys, returning JSON for portfolio, ownership, transaction, benchmark, admin (roles, teams, users) and reporting resources; API access requires an active Addepar subscription.[2,4,11]
- Integration Center offers portfolio data feeds, market data feeds and third-party applications or services, with clear labeling of feeds that are “Included with Addepar” versus “Premium”, and details on update frequency, coverage and security types.[8,9,10]
- Independent SOC 3 report covering the Analytics & Reporting and Navigator platforms, combined with role-based access control, audit endpoints and granular permissions surfaced via the developer API.[4,12]
Data partners
ICE Data Services
Provides end-of-day pricing for global equities, mutual funds, ETFs and other asset types via the ICE Pricing feed, included with Addepar.
Morningstar
Supplies reference data, benchmarks and mutual-fund constituents via included and premium Market Data Feeds.
PitchBook
Provides alternatives data as an included Market Data Feed for private markets analytics.
Cambridge Associates
Offers private investment benchmarks as a premium Market Data Feed for alternatives analytics.[8,10]
Hedge Fund Research (HFR)
Delivers hedge fund index benchmarks through the Market Data Feeds catalog.
FAQ
Is Addepar free?
No. Addepar does not offer a free plan. Expect subscription pricing when you onboard. Check the vendor site for the most recent offers. Enterprise quotes are handled directly with the vendor.
Who is Addepar best for?
Addepar is built for Institutional Investors, Financial Advisors, RIAs / Wealth Firms, Family Offices, and Asset Managers. It suits intermediate and advanced users.
What platforms and connections does Addepar support?
You can use Addepar on Web and Mobile. Addepar offers an API (REST) with APIKey and OAuth2 authentication. Integrations include Fidelity, Schwab, ICE, Morningstar, PitchBook, Coinbase + 4 more.
Which markets does Addepar cover?
Addepar covers North America, Europe, APAC, LatAm, Middle East, and Africa. It tracks Stocks, Bonds, ETFs, Mutual Funds, Closed-End Funds, Funds + 6 more. Identifiers include CUSIP, ISIN, SEDOL, and Ticker.
